Father of missing boy gives saliva sample
Dawan Ferguson, father of a severely disabled 9-year-old boy missing since Wednesday, provided a saliva sample Monday to St. Louis police but refused to answer questions, officials said.
If authorities find a body, they could use the sample to determine whether it is Christian Ferguson, who lives with his father in Pine Lawn.
By Monday night, there was still no sign of the boy. His family has said he could not live much beyond 24 hours without medication for a rare disorder that inhibits his processing of protein. Christian cannot communicate or take care of himself.
Dawan Ferguson, 30, told police someone drove off in his SUV when he stopped to make a call at a pay phone in St. Louis about 6 a.m. Wednesday. The vehicle was recovered empty in the city of Ferguson about two hours later.
Ferguson talked to police Wednesday morning but eventually requested a lawyer and declined to say more, officers said. Post-Dispatch
